在移动互联网浪潮里,前端技术早已跳脱出“网页装饰”的标签,成为决定App成败的关键环节。前端负责的并非只有界面,而是从交互逻辑、动画流畅度到跨平台兼容的全链路体验。面对多终端、多分辨率和复杂业务场景,正确的前端技术选型能带来更短的开发周期、更低的维护成本和更高的用户满意度与留存率。
常见的技术路线包括纯原生开发、混合开发(如Cordova、Ionic)、跨平台框架(ReactNative、Flutter)以及基于Web技术的PWA方案。每种方案都有适配的场景:原生适合对性能和平台特性要求极高的应用;ReactNative在团队已有Web前端基础时可快速上手;Flutter以其渲染一致性和高性能动画吸引设计驱动型产品;Ionic/Cordova则在web代码复用上具有优势。
选择的核心维度应围绕项目需求:界面复杂度、动画与渲染要求、接入原生能力的深度、团队技术栈和上线节奏。除此之外,模块化与组件化设计是前端架构成功的另一基石。通过将UI拆分为可复用的组件、抽离公共样式与交互约定,团队可以在保证一致性的同时加速迭代。
还要关注构建与发布链路:自动化构建、持续集成、热更新方案和灰度发布机制,能显著降低上线风险并缩短修复周期。前端性能优化也不能忽视,从减少渲染阻塞、降低绘制次数、合理使用缓存到对网络请求进行合并与压缩,都是提升App流畅度与省电省流量体验的细节。
现代前端工具链(如Bundle分析、Profile性能分析、视觉回放工具)可以让调优更有据可依,而不是凭经验盲改。移动App的前端不是孤立的前台美工,它是串联产品、设计与后端的体验发动机,选对技术与构建合理流程,能把产品价值和用户口碑最大化。
当项目进入实施阶段,如何把前端优势真正转化为产品竞争力?首先是明确优先级:把最关键的用户路径做得最流畅,把核心功能的响应时间压到最低。针对不同平台,采用合理的混合策略也能兼顾速度与体验。例如主流程使用跨平台框架以缩短开发时间,而对音视频、复杂绘制等高性能模块采用原生模块接入,做到取长补短。
其次是组件与设计系统的建设:统一的设计语言、交互规范和可复用组件库,不只让界面一致更美观,还能减少沟通成本。第三,在开发流程上推动端到端的自动化:从代码静态检查、单元测试、UI自动化测试到灰度发布链路,都是保证质量与快速迭代的利器。安全方面,前端需做好数据加密、本地存储管理、鉴权过期处理与敏感信息防泄露,任何疏忽都会影响用户信任。
还要重视离线策略与网络波动处理,合理的缓存策略、请求重试与降级体验,能在不良网络环境下保住关键业务。最后别忽略数据驱动的持续优化:通过埋点与分析,跟踪用户行为、卡顿点与功能转化率,用真实数据指导迭代优先级。经典案例显示,前端优化带来的留存增长往往超过单纯功能迭代的提升。
在选择合作伙伴或组建团队时,评估其在性能调优、复杂动画实现、原生桥接和持续交付方面的实战经验,往往比单纯看框架熟练度更有价值。如果你在考虑启动或重构移动App前端,我们可以提供技术评估、原型开发和性能调优支持,帮助你以最合适的成本交付最佳体验,让产品在激烈的市场中脱颖而出。